What is the Small Estate Affidavit For Estates Under $50,000 New Mexico
The Small Estate Affidavit for estates under $50,000 in New Mexico is a legal document that allows heirs or beneficiaries to claim property without going through the formal probate process. This affidavit simplifies the transfer of assets for small estates, making it easier for individuals to manage the estate of a deceased person. It is particularly beneficial for estates that do not exceed the specified monetary limit, as it reduces time, costs, and the complexity typically associated with probate proceedings.
How to use the Small Estate Affidavit For Estates Under $50,000 New Mexico
To use the Small Estate Affidavit in New Mexico, an individual must first ensure that the estate qualifies under the $50,000 threshold. The next step involves completing the affidavit form, which requires details about the deceased, the heirs, and the assets involved. Once the form is completed, it must be signed in front of a notary public. After notarization, the affidavit can be presented to financial institutions or other entities holding the deceased's assets to facilitate the transfer.
Steps to complete the Small Estate Affidavit For Estates Under $50,000 New Mexico
Completing the Small Estate Affidavit involves several key steps:
- Gather necessary information about the deceased, including their full name, date of death, and details of the estate.
- Obtain the Small Estate Affidavit form, which can typically be found through state resources or legal aid organizations.
- Fill out the form accurately, ensuring all required information is included.
- Sign the affidavit in the presence of a notary public to ensure its validity.
- Submit the notarized affidavit to the relevant institutions to claim the assets.
Key elements of the Small Estate Affidavit For Estates Under $50,000 New Mexico
Several key elements must be included in the Small Estate Affidavit for it to be valid:
- The full name and address of the deceased.
- The date of death and a statement confirming that the estate's total value is under $50,000.
- The names and addresses of all heirs or beneficiaries.
- A description of the assets being claimed.
- A declaration that the affiant is entitled to the property as per state laws.
